TEKsystems Senior ReactJS Developer in Jacksonville, Florida

Description

Sr. React Developers are responsible for the development, programming, and coding of Information Technology solutions using ReactJS, Redux, D3 and NodeJS to enable Florida Blue Customer Experience applications. They will engage in all phases of the software development lifecycle which include: gathering and analyzing user/business system requirements, responding to outages and creating application system models. Developers are responsible for documenting detailed system specifications and will participate in evaluating, conducting performance testing, and all planned and unplanned maintenance for both internally developed applications and purchased products. They will participate in design meetings and consult with clients to refine, test and debug programs to meet business needs and interact and sometimes direct third party partners in the achievement of business and technology initiatives. Developers are responsible for including IT Controls to protect the confidentiality, integrity, as well as availability of the application and data processed or output by the application.
